The Gut–Skin Axis: Is Your Diet Causing Breakouts?
Are are using the “right” cleanser, invested in the serums, diligent with SPF and even have a home LED mask (the one recommended by me of course) BUT skin breakouts keep coming?
You’re not alone.
In clinic here in Hale, I meet so many patients who feel frustrated and defeated by their skin. They are doing everything “right” on the outside but what they don’t realise is that the conversation between your gut and your skin can be just as important as what you put on your face.
What am I talking about? This is the gut–skin axis, a fascinating, growing area of research linking your microbiome, hormones, diet, stress, and inflammation. In other words, your skin isn’t just a surface problem. It’s part of your whole system.

The Elegant Approach to Perimenopausal Skin: Understanding & Treating Midlife Hormonal Changes
Perimenopause. Otherwise known as those years leading up to the menopause. It’s a time of profound change. While it’s often discussed in terms of hot flushes, mood shifts, and sleep disruption, your skin is also undergoing a quiet transformation of its own. For many women in their 40s and 50s, the mirror begins to reflect subtle changes: a new dryness, less radiance, or a softening of facial contours.
